{"id":"https://openalex.org/W2950542868","doi":"https://doi.org/10.1109/icde.2016.7498258","title":"NXgraph: An efficient graph processing system on a single machine","display_name":"NXgraph: An efficient graph processing system on a single machine","publication_year":2016,"publication_date":"2016-05-01","ids":{"openalex":"https://openalex.org/W2950542868","doi":"https://doi.org/10.1109/icde.2016.7498258","mag":"2950542868"},"language":"en","primary_location":{"id":"doi:10.1109/icde.2016.7498258","is_oa":false,"landing_page_url":"https://doi.org/10.1109/icde.2016.7498258","pdf_url":null,"source":null,"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"2016 IEEE 32nd International Conference on Data Engineering (ICDE)","raw_type":"proceedings-article"},"type":"preprint","indexed_in":["arxiv","crossref"],"open_access":{"is_oa":true,"oa_status":"green","oa_url":"https://arxiv.org/pdf/1510.06916","any_repository_has_fulltext":true},"authorships":[{"author_position":"first","author":{"id":"https://openalex.org/A5074835029","display_name":"Yuze Chi","orcid":"https://orcid.org/0000-0002-5885-0425"},"institutions":[{"id":"https://openalex.org/I99065089","display_name":"Tsinghua University","ror":"https://ror.org/03cve4549","country_code":"CN","type":"education","lineage":["https://openalex.org/I99065089"]}],"countries":["CN"],"is_corresponding":true,"raw_author_name":"Yuze Chi","raw_affiliation_strings":["Tsinghua National Laboratory for Information Science and Technology, Tsinghua University"],"affiliations":[{"raw_affiliation_string":"Tsinghua National Laboratory for Information Science and Technology, Tsinghua University","institution_ids":["https://openalex.org/I99065089"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5102805465","display_name":"Guohao Dai","orcid":"https://orcid.org/0000-0002-8464-0130"},"institutions":[{"id":"https://openalex.org/I99065089","display_name":"Tsinghua University","ror":"https://ror.org/03cve4549","country_code":"CN","type":"education","lineage":["https://openalex.org/I99065089"]}],"countries":["CN"],"is_corresponding":false,"raw_author_name":"Guohao Dai","raw_affiliation_strings":["Tsinghua National Laboratory for Information Science and Technology, Tsinghua University"],"affiliations":[{"raw_affiliation_string":"Tsinghua National Laboratory for Information Science and Technology, Tsinghua University","institution_ids":["https://openalex.org/I99065089"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5100445061","display_name":"Yu Wang","orcid":"https://orcid.org/0000-0001-6108-5157"},"institutions":[{"id":"https://openalex.org/I99065089","display_name":"Tsinghua University","ror":"https://ror.org/03cve4549","country_code":"CN","type":"education","lineage":["https://openalex.org/I99065089"]}],"countries":["CN"],"is_corresponding":false,"raw_author_name":"Yu Wang","raw_affiliation_strings":["Tsinghua National Laboratory for Information Science and Technology, Tsinghua University"],"affiliations":[{"raw_affiliation_string":"Tsinghua National Laboratory for Information Science and Technology, Tsinghua University","institution_ids":["https://openalex.org/I99065089"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5101850376","display_name":"Guangyu Sun","orcid":"https://orcid.org/0000-0001-6436-0820"},"institutions":[{"id":"https://openalex.org/I20231570","display_name":"Peking University","ror":"https://ror.org/02v51f717","country_code":"CN","type":"education","lineage":["https://openalex.org/I20231570"]}],"countries":["CN"],"is_corresponding":false,"raw_author_name":"Guangyu Sun","raw_affiliation_strings":["Center for Energy Efficient Computing and Applications, Peking University"],"affiliations":[{"raw_affiliation_string":"Center for Energy Efficient Computing and Applications, Peking University","institution_ids":["https://openalex.org/I20231570"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5100451576","display_name":"Guoliang Li","orcid":"https://orcid.org/0000-0002-1398-0621"},"institutions":[{"id":"https://openalex.org/I99065089","display_name":"Tsinghua University","ror":"https://ror.org/03cve4549","country_code":"CN","type":"education","lineage":["https://openalex.org/I99065089"]}],"countries":["CN"],"is_corresponding":false,"raw_author_name":"Guoliang Li","raw_affiliation_strings":["Tsinghua National Laboratory for Information Science and Technology, Tsinghua University"],"affiliations":[{"raw_affiliation_string":"Tsinghua National Laboratory for Information Science and Technology, Tsinghua University","institution_ids":["https://openalex.org/I99065089"]}]},{"author_position":"last","author":{"id":"https://openalex.org/A5103867707","display_name":"Huazhong Yang","orcid":null},"institutions":[{"id":"https://openalex.org/I99065089","display_name":"Tsinghua University","ror":"https://ror.org/03cve4549","country_code":"CN","type":"education","lineage":["https://openalex.org/I99065089"]}],"countries":["CN"],"is_corresponding":false,"raw_author_name":"Huazhong Yang","raw_affiliation_strings":["Tsinghua National Laboratory for Information Science and Technology, Tsinghua University"],"affiliations":[{"raw_affiliation_string":"Tsinghua National Laboratory for Information Science and Technology, Tsinghua University","institution_ids":["https://openalex.org/I99065089"]}]}],"institutions":[],"countries_distinct_count":1,"institutions_distinct_count":6,"corresponding_author_ids":["https://openalex.org/A5074835029"],"corresponding_institution_ids":["https://openalex.org/I99065089"],"apc_list":null,"apc_paid":null,"fwci":7.28,"has_fulltext":false,"cited_by_count":88,"citation_normalized_percentile":{"value":0.98218307,"is_in_top_1_percent":false,"is_in_top_10_percent":true},"cited_by_percentile_year":{"min":94,"max":100},"biblio":{"volume":null,"issue":null,"first_page":"409","last_page":"420"},"is_retracted":false,"is_paratext":false,"is_xpac":false,"primary_topic":{"id":"https://openalex.org/T12292","display_name":"Graph Theory and Algorithms","score":1.0,"subfield":{"id":"https://openalex.org/subfields/1707","display_name":"Computer Vision and Pattern Recognition"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},"topics":[{"id":"https://openalex.org/T12292","display_name":"Graph Theory and Algorithms","score":1.0,"subfield":{"id":"https://openalex.org/subfields/1707","display_name":"Computer Vision and Pattern Recognition"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T11273","display_name":"Advanced Graph Neural Networks","score":0.9966999888420105,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10101","display_name":"Cloud Computing and Resource Management","score":0.9954000115394592,"subfield":{"id":"https://openalex.org/subfields/1710","display_name":"Information Systems"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}}],"keywords":[{"id":"https://openalex.org/keywords/computer-science","display_name":"Computer science","score":0.7920647859573364},{"id":"https://openalex.org/keywords/parallel-computing","display_name":"Parallel computing","score":0.5226204991340637},{"id":"https://openalex.org/keywords/graph","display_name":"Graph","score":0.5031794905662537},{"id":"https://openalex.org/keywords/theoretical-computer-science","display_name":"Theoretical computer science","score":0.36760279536247253}],"concepts":[{"id":"https://openalex.org/C41008148","wikidata":"https://www.wikidata.org/wiki/Q21198","display_name":"Computer science","level":0,"score":0.7920647859573364},{"id":"https://openalex.org/C173608175","wikidata":"https://www.wikidata.org/wiki/Q232661","display_name":"Parallel computing","level":1,"score":0.5226204991340637},{"id":"https://openalex.org/C132525143","wikidata":"https://www.wikidata.org/wiki/Q141488","display_name":"Graph","level":2,"score":0.5031794905662537},{"id":"https://openalex.org/C80444323","wikidata":"https://www.wikidata.org/wiki/Q2878974","display_name":"Theoretical computer science","level":1,"score":0.36760279536247253}],"mesh":[],"locations_count":2,"locations":[{"id":"doi:10.1109/icde.2016.7498258","is_oa":false,"landing_page_url":"https://doi.org/10.1109/icde.2016.7498258","pdf_url":null,"source":null,"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"2016 IEEE 32nd International Conference on Data Engineering (ICDE)","raw_type":"proceedings-article"},{"id":"pmh:oai:arXiv.org:1510.06916","is_oa":true,"landing_page_url":"http://arxiv.org/abs/1510.06916","pdf_url":"https://arxiv.org/pdf/1510.06916","source":{"id":"https://openalex.org/S4306400194","display_name":"arXiv (Cornell University)","issn_l":null,"issn":null,"is_oa":true,"is_in_doaj":false,"is_core":false,"host_organization":"https://openalex.org/I205783295","host_organization_name":"Cornell University","host_organization_lineage":["https://openalex.org/I205783295"],"host_organization_lineage_names":[],"type":"repository"},"license":null,"license_id":null,"version":"submittedVersion","is_accepted":false,"is_published":false,"raw_source_name":null,"raw_type":"text"}],"best_oa_location":{"id":"pmh:oai:arXiv.org:1510.06916","is_oa":true,"landing_page_url":"http://arxiv.org/abs/1510.06916","pdf_url":"https://arxiv.org/pdf/1510.06916","source":{"id":"https://openalex.org/S4306400194","display_name":"arXiv (Cornell University)","issn_l":null,"issn":null,"is_oa":true,"is_in_doaj":false,"is_core":false,"host_organization":"https://openalex.org/I205783295","host_organization_name":"Cornell University","host_organization_lineage":["https://openalex.org/I205783295"],"host_organization_lineage_names":[],"type":"repository"},"license":null,"license_id":null,"version":"submittedVersion","is_accepted":false,"is_published":false,"raw_source_name":null,"raw_type":"text"},"sustainable_development_goals":[],"awards":[],"funders":[],"has_content":{"pdf":false,"grobid_xml":false},"content_urls":null,"referenced_works_count":38,"referenced_works":["https://openalex.org/W78077100","https://openalex.org/W1448681276","https://openalex.org/W1533316337","https://openalex.org/W1788180225","https://openalex.org/W1832683484","https://openalex.org/W1854214752","https://openalex.org/W1896160955","https://openalex.org/W1975283025","https://openalex.org/W1980210945","https://openalex.org/W1987634495","https://openalex.org/W1993219230","https://openalex.org/W2021685712","https://openalex.org/W2034343031","https://openalex.org/W2046526098","https://openalex.org/W2052759865","https://openalex.org/W2053076698","https://openalex.org/W2055497547","https://openalex.org/W2101196063","https://openalex.org/W2104329103","https://openalex.org/W2109282506","https://openalex.org/W2112651225","https://openalex.org/W2123538390","https://openalex.org/W2130747448","https://openalex.org/W2144085134","https://openalex.org/W2150481406","https://openalex.org/W2160459668","https://openalex.org/W2167927436","https://openalex.org/W2170616854","https://openalex.org/W2173213060","https://openalex.org/W2189465200","https://openalex.org/W2951113132","https://openalex.org/W4253426709","https://openalex.org/W6603201521","https://openalex.org/W6628546715","https://openalex.org/W6638233953","https://openalex.org/W6638659379","https://openalex.org/W6639805184","https://openalex.org/W6687322159"],"related_works":["https://openalex.org/W4391375266","https://openalex.org/W2899084033","https://openalex.org/W2748952813","https://openalex.org/W2390279801","https://openalex.org/W4391913857","https://openalex.org/W2358668433","https://openalex.org/W4396701345","https://openalex.org/W2376932109","https://openalex.org/W2001405890","https://openalex.org/W4396696052"],"abstract_inverted_index":{"Recent":[0],"studies":[1],"show":[2,164],"that":[3,165],"graph":[4,18,29,49,120,125,194,206],"processing":[5,19,30,207],"systems":[6],"on":[7,32,156,179,190,216],"a":[8,33,45,75,180,204,217],"single":[9,34,181],"machine":[10],"can":[11,112,184],"achieve":[12,74],"competitive":[13],"performance":[14],"compared":[15],"with":[16,195],"cluster-based":[17],"systems.":[20],"In":[21],"this":[22,109],"paper,":[23],"we":[24],"present":[25],"NXgraph,":[26,177],"an":[27,186],"efficient":[28],"system":[31],"machine.":[35],"We":[36],"propose":[37],"the":[38,115,124,128,135,140,191,213],"Destination-Sorted":[39],"Sub-Shard":[40],"(DSSS)":[41],"structure":[42],"to":[43,87,123,132,211],"store":[44],"graph.":[46],"To":[47,66],"ensure":[48],"data":[50,143],"access":[51,152],"locality":[52],"and":[53,60,64,73,102,127,138,160,171],"enable":[54],"fine-grained":[55],"scheduling,":[56],"NXgraph":[57,80,111,166],"divides":[58],"vertices":[59],"edges":[61,82,198],"into":[62],"intervals":[63],"sub-shards.":[65],"reduce":[67,139],"write":[68],"conflicts":[69],"among":[70],"different":[71,119],"threads":[72],"high":[76],"degree":[77],"of":[78,142,188],"parallelism,":[79],"sorts":[81],"within":[83],"each":[84],"sub-shard":[85],"according":[86,122],"their":[88],"destination":[89],"vertices.":[90],"Then,":[91],"three":[92,147,157],"updating":[93],"strategies,":[94],"i.e.,":[95],"Single-Phase":[96],"Update":[97,100,104],"(SPU),":[98],"Double-Phase":[99],"(DPU),":[101],"Mixed-Phase":[103],"(MPU),":[105],"are":[106],"proposed":[107],"in":[108,173,199],"paper.":[110],"adaptively":[113],"choose":[114],"fastest":[116],"strategy":[117],"for":[118],"problems":[121],"size":[126],"available":[129],"memory":[130,136],"resources":[131],"fully":[133],"utilize":[134],"space":[137],"amount":[141],"transfer.":[144],"All":[145],"these":[146],"strategies":[148],"exploit":[149],"streamlined":[150],"disk":[151],"patterns.":[153],"Extensive":[154],"experiments":[155],"real-world":[158],"graphs":[159,163],"five":[161],"synthetic":[162],"outperforms":[167],"GraphChi,":[168],"TurboGraph,":[169],"VENUS,":[170],"GridGraph":[172],"various":[174],"situations.":[175],"Moreover,":[176],"running":[178],"commodity":[182],"PC,":[183],"finish":[185,212],"iteration":[187],"PageRank":[189],"Twitter":[192],"[1]":[193],"1.5":[196],"billion":[197],"2.05":[200],"seconds;":[201],"while":[202],"PowerGraph,":[203],"distributed":[205],"system,":[208],"needs":[209],"3.6s":[210],"same":[214],"task":[215],"64-node":[218],"cluster.":[219]},"counts_by_year":[{"year":2025,"cited_by_count":4},{"year":2024,"cited_by_count":3},{"year":2023,"cited_by_count":2},{"year":2022,"cited_by_count":14},{"year":2021,"cited_by_count":11},{"year":2020,"cited_by_count":11},{"year":2019,"cited_by_count":19},{"year":2018,"cited_by_count":15},{"year":2017,"cited_by_count":7},{"year":2016,"cited_by_count":2}],"updated_date":"2026-03-10T16:38:18.471706","created_date":"2025-10-10T00:00:00"}
